Is there really a tax relief program?

Yes, the IRS offers several tax relief programs designed to help taxpayers facing financial hardship. These programs include options for settling debt for less than the full amount or setting up manageable payment plans. We guide you through the application process for these programs.

What qualifies for tax relief?

Qualifying for tax relief typically depends on your financial circumstances, including your income, expenses, and assets. The IRS evaluates these factors to determine eligibility for programs like Offer in Compromise or installment agreements. We assess your specific situation to identify potential relief options.
